It may be Aerial Work if anyone is making money out of the flight, not necessarily the pilot. For example, if a PPL takes a professional photographer on a flight with the intention that the photographer does commercial work, it's Aerial Work even if the PPL doesn't get paid.

Given that what you are talking of is rather public, I'd get advice of the CAA first. See http://www.nats-uk.ead-it.com/aip/cu...8_W_070_en.pdf - it has contact details for the CAA.
